Week 1: Taking it Slow

The initial week following a tummy tuck is important for your healing. You’ll experience some swelling, bruising, and mild discomfort, which are normal reactions your body has to surgery. Your surgeon will likely recommend wearing a compression garment to reduce swelling and support your new abdominal shape. Drains might also be placed to help remove excess fluids and reduce complications. Gentle movements around the house, like short walks, are encouraged to promote circulation, but avoiding strenuous activities and getting plenty of rest is important.

Weeks 2-3: Noticeable Progress

By your second and third week, you’ll begin to notice substantial improvement. Swelling and bruising start to diminish significantly, and discomfort becomes manageable, often reduced to minor soreness. At this stage, most patients can resume basic activities but should continue avoiding heavy lifting and vigorous exercise. Regular walking can continue and will aid your healing process.

Week 4: Gaining Momentum

Many individuals can comfortably return to desk jobs or non-strenuous work at around four weeks. Your body will continue to heal, revealing more clearly the results of your tummy tuck as swelling continues to decrease. While you may feel eager to resume full activities, it’s vital to remain patient and cautious, as the underlying tissues still require more time to heal fully.

Weeks 5-6: Returning to Regular Activities

With your surgeon’s guidance, more active pursuits can gradually be reintroduced at this stage. Gentle exercise like yoga, stretching, or light cardio can help strengthen your core and improve your recovery. Always listen to your body and proceed at a comfortable pace, being cautious to avoid straining the healing area.

Months 2-3: Embracing the New You

By the second or third month, most of the initial recovery process is behind you. Swelling should be minimal, if present at all, and you’ll be enjoying the clearer, contoured results of your surgery. Scar tissue will continue to fade over time, especially with proper care, such as sun protection and moisturizing treatments.

Essential Recovery Tips for Optimal Healing

  • Follow your surgeon’s advice: Adhering strictly to post-operative instructions will significantly enhance your recovery.
  • Wear your compression garment: This reduces swelling, supports healing, and helps shape your new abdominal contours.
  • Stay hydrated and maintain a balanced diet: Proper nutrition aids the body’s natural healing process and boosts overall energy.
  • Avoid smoking and alcohol: These can negatively impact your healing, increasing the risk of complications and slowing your recovery.
